IHC directs ATIR to decide M/s Hi Wings Travels plea within 45 days

ISLAMABAD: Hearing a tax petition, the Islamabad High Court (IHC) has restricted the Regional Tax Office from realizing the outstanding tax of Rs 3.9 million from M/s Hi Wings Travels and Tours Operators (Private) Limited.

A single bench of the IHC comprising Justice Aamer Farooq heard the case and also issued directives to the Appellate Tribunal Inland Revenue to decide the appellant’s application pertaining to the tax claims within 45 days.

Justice Aamer Farooq issued these directives, adding that the FBR must abstain from recovering the outstanding tax amount claimed by the RTO for the tax year 2013.

The RTO had issued the order creating demand of the amount on May 28, 2015 which was challenged at the department, then at the ATIR and lastly before the IHC. The FBR field office had created the demand under provisions of Income Tax Ordinance.

The FBR, RTO’s Chief Commissioner, Commissioner Inland Revenue, Commissioner Inland Revenue (Appeals), Assistant Commissioner Inland Revenue and ATIR were made party in the case.
